Work Visa Application Process

The process of applying for a work visa consists of several stages:

🔹 1. Obtaining a work permit:
The employer submits an application to the provincial office, attaching the required documents, such as a job description, confirmation of recruitment and other necessary formalities.

2. Preparation of documents

the applicant must collect a set of required documents:
• Valid passport
• Completed visa application
• Current passport photo
• Employment contract or other document confirming employment
• Documents confirming qualifications (diplomas, certificates)
•Confirmation of health insurance

3. Submission of the application

after completing the documents, the application must be submitted to the Polish consulate or embassy in the country of origin. In many cases, it is necessary to make an appointment in advance.

4. Visa fee

The cost of a visa depends on its type and period of validity.

5. Waiting time

the time of consideration of the application depends on the individual case and can range from several weeks to several months. It is recommended to apply well in advance.

Coming to Poland — What's Next?


After obtaining a visa and arriving in Poland, you need to remember several important formalities:

📌 Registration of residence

If you plan to stay longer than 90 days, you must report to the municipal office (commune) and register within 30 days of arrival.

📌 PESEL Number

If you intend to live and work in Poland permanently, you should get a PESEL number, which is necessary to carry out many administrative formalities.
